bmu*_*l30 1 c# xml visual-studio-2012
我的项目包括一个组合框,其中包含供用户选择的数据库列表.选择确定稍后将联系哪个数据库.
由于数据库具有奇数名称,因此我想给每个数据库提供一个可理解的名称,以便在组合框的显示值中显示,实际数据库名称隐藏在Value Member属性中(即"XYZprojDB123"的"数据库1").因此,我将具有显示值/值成员对的XML文件放在一起,并将其添加到我在Visual Studio中的项目中,但现在我无法在我的代码中链接到它.只是写作
XDocument dbList = XDocument.Load("Databases.xml");
Run Code Online (Sandbox Code Playgroud)
不起作用.
这是一个Windows应用程序,因此我希望在发布时包含此XML文件以进行分发.有谁知道如何使这项工作?
如果XML文件已添加到您的项目中:
NoneCopy if newer完成后,您的xml文件将被复制到项目的本地目录中,并且XDocument dbList = XDocument.Load("Databases.xml");应该可以正常工作.